WebOct 4, 2024 · Trichomonas vaginalis is a pear-shaped flagellated protozoan possessing five flagella, four located at its anterior portion. To prevent being infected … crystal\\u0027s ikWebDec 24, 2024 · Parabasalids move with flagella and membrane rippling. Trichomonas vaginalis, a parabasalid that causes a sexually-transmitted disease in humans, employs these mechanisms to transit through the male and female urogenital tracts.
